摘要

[Problem] To make it possible to reduce the effects of electrode expansion and contraction in a power storage device, and to maintain the battery properties of the device. [Solution] An electrode 2, 4 of a power storage device according to the present invention comprises: metal fibers A; an adsorptive material powder on which electrolyte ions adsorb during charging and discharging or an active material powder 11, 21 which undergoes a chemical reaction during charging and discharging, the adsorptive material powder or active material powder 11, 21 being in contact with the metal fibers A; and a solid electrolyte 14, 24 in powder form which is in contact with the metal fibers A.
